13: (sample answer)
In my opinion, technology will
continue to bring both positive and
negative changes to our lives. Most
people will be connected to the
Internet at home so more of them will
be able to work from home. They
won't have to travel to their offices
every day. This will reduce the
amount of traffic on the roads, which
will reduce pollution. On the negative
side, life will also get faster and
people will get even more stressed. I
hope that we’ll find a way of dealing
with this stress and be able to live
with technology in a healthier way.
